I created my application to implement
gravity. I'm sending a pickray directly down from the viewplatform.
If the ray hits the ground, and the ground is below the "feet" you "fall" down
the y axis.
The problem is that when the avatar is far from any
pickable objects, the ray fails to pick anything and I'm left floating in
midair. When I float over an object that is closer, the whole thing works
and I fall with proper acceleration and everything.
I thought a pickray was infinite, why doesn't it
work? Is this a bounds issue? What node would need a bigger bounding
box?
